Transaction 683645a6a5c2de8e2955b6d99b61dae781a62d5fb5944aebb710b87e1812713f
1 Input
1 Output
-
683645a6a5c2de8e2955b6d99b61dae781a62d5fb5944aebb710b87e1812713f:0
- value
- 1018638
- script pubkey
- OP_0 OP_PUSHBYTES_20 31965523da7d56208b9a384d5d1cf88746263405
- address
- bc1qxxt92g7604tzpzu68px4688csarzvdq9vxt7a0